August 31 (SeeNews) - The foreign exchange (FX) reserves held by Albania's central bank totalled $4.3 billion (3.6 billion euro) at the end of July, down 1.8% year-on-year, central bank data showed on Tuesday.
On a monthly comparison basis, the central bank's FX reserves edged up 0.3% at the end of July, the data showed.
